Pearl-Continental Hotels in Pakistan is Coming to Hunza Valley
Embracing the beauty and splendor of Lake Atta Abad and combining first-class friendliness, another Pearl Continental Hotel will soon open in the scenic Hunza Valley. A turquoise lake surrounded by the majestic Karakorum Mountains, the 5-star Pearl Continental Hotel Atta Abad Lake will appeal to both explorers and adventure travelers.

Visitors can choose from a total of 112 standard guest rooms and four visitor suites that open onto visiting lanais and private dining areas. A variety of cuisines are also available in the all-day dining restaurant, Mezzanine Espresso, Bar Lounge, Terrace, Rooftop or Poolside.
Considering the numerous health and sports facilities, the property will be equipped with a gym, wellness center, spa and swimming pool. These hotels in Pakistan also offer yoga retreats for yoga professionals.
